From: Roman Gushchin <guro@fb.com>
Subject: mm: memcg/slab: fix obj_cgroup_charge() return value handling
Commit 10befea91b61 ("mm: memcg/slab: use a single set of kmem_caches for
all allocations") introduced a regression into the handling of the
obj_cgroup_charge() return value. If a non-zero value is returned
(indicating of exceeding one of memory.max limits), the allocation should
fail, instead of falling back to non-accounted mode.
To make the code more readable, move memcg_slab_pre_alloc_hook() and
memcg_slab_post_alloc_hook() calling conditions into bodies of these
hooks.
